Swap out your aging mechanical drives for solid-state reliability. Powered by a Raspberry Pi Pico (RP2040/RP2350), BlueSCSI replaces expensive, rare parts with modern tech. Just pop in an SD card and go!
Emulate up to 7 SCSI devices at once! Hard drives, CD-ROMs, tape drives, MO, Zip, and even network adapters. BlueSCSI is your all-in-one SCSI solution.

With a Pico-W, your BlueSCSI can emulate a DaynaPORT SCSI/Link, bringing wireless networking to your vintage machines. Browse the web, connect to FTP sites, and more!
Learn MorePreserve your original SCSI drives! Initiator Mode allows you to connect a vintage drive directly to your BlueSCSI and create a perfect disk image on the SD card. It's an invaluable tool for data archival.
Learn MorePush the limits of your hardware with SCSI Fast20 support, achieving speeds up to 18MB/sec. Unleash the full potential of your high-end vintage workstations.
Learn MoreGo beyond simple drive emulation with the BlueSCSI Toolbox, a suite of powerful applications that run directly on your vintage computer. This unique feature allows you to interact with your BlueSCSI in ways no other SCSI emulator can.
Easily move files between the SD card and your vintage machine.
Change CD images on the fly without ever touching the SD card.
Configure Wi-Fi settings and manage your BlueSCSI directly from your classic OS.
Available for: Classic Macintosh, Amiga, Atari, DOS, Windows, IRIX and more coming soon!
